Python client for the Arenza MCP server — programmatic access to AI visibility metrics, brand mentions, hallucination findings, and GEO opportunities across ChatGPT, Claude, Gemini, Perplexity, Copilot, and Grok.
Arenza is a Generative Engine Optimization (GEO) platform that measures how 6 leading AI assistants — ChatGPT, Claude, Gemini, Perplexity, Copilot, and Grok — describe brands across multiple markets (US, UK, DE, JP, and more). This package wraps the Model Context Protocol server at mcp.arenza.ai so Python apps, scripts, agents, and notebooks get typed access to the same data the Arenza dashboard renders — share-of-voice across LLMs, wrong-claim findings, GEO opportunities, competitor benchmarks, and AI-search prompt analytics.
The Arenza data surface ships as both a REST API (api.arenza.ai) and an MCP server (mcp.arenza.ai). The MCP variant is what AI agents — Claude Desktop, Claude Code, Cursor, Continue, and any custom agent built on the MCP protocol — connect to natively. This client lets you embed the same connection inside a Python backend, FastAPI service, Airflow DAG, or LLM agent loop, with both synchronous and asynchronous APIs.

pip install arenza-mcp-client
# or with uv
uv add arenza-mcp-client
# or with poetry
poetry add arenza-mcp-clientRequires Python 3.10+.

asyncio.run(main())The Arenza MCP server exposes 10 tools (6 read, 4 write):
| Method | Description |
|---|---|
list_brands() |
List all brands in the authenticated tenant's portfolio. |
get_brand_overview(brand_id) |
Aggregate visibility + accuracy snapshot for one brand. |
list_prompts(brand_id, intent=None) |
List the AI-assistant prompts probed for a brand, with mention rates per LLM. |
list_opportunities(brand_id, type=None) |
List measurement-led GEO opportunities (wrong claims to fix, missing canonical pages, listicle gaps, discussion seeds). |
suggest_competitors(brand_id, count=None) |
LLM-suggested competitors based on the brand description. |
suggest_prompts(brand_id, competitors=None, count=None, locale=None) |
LLM-generated buyer-perspective prompts (70%+ unbranded ratio enforced). |
| Method | Description |
|---|---|
add_competitor(brand_id, name, domain) |
Add a competitor to a brand's tracking list. |
dismiss_competitor(brand_id, competitor_id) |
Remove a competitor (e.g. wrong suggestion). |
mark_opportunity_done(opportunity_id) |
Mark a GEO opportunity as completed. |
generate_geo_article(brand_id, linked_claim_id, locale=None) |
Draft a canonical-fact article body anchored to a specific finding. |
Each tool has full type hints — your IDE / mypy / pyright will autocomplete parameters and return shapes.
API token (simplest for backends, scripts, cron jobs):
import os
from arenza_mcp_client import ArenzaMCPClient
client = ArenzaMCPClient(token=os.environ["ARENZA_TOKEN"])Get one at app.arenza.ai/settings/api.
OAuth 2.0 + DCR + PKCE is the recommended flow for multi-tenant apps. The Arenza MCP server publishes its OAuth metadata at mcp.arenza.ai/.well-known/oauth-authorization-server. For Python, pair this client with authlib — DCR helpers ship in the next release.

- Free tier: 100 MCP calls/hour
- Pro tier ($299/mo): 1,000 calls/hour
- Protect tier ($799/mo): 10,000 calls/hour
- Enterprise: unlimited
The remaining quota is returned in the X-RateLimit-Remaining response header. This client does not auto-retry on HTTP 429 — handle backoff in your own code.
